Helen M Melko's Obituary
Helen Melko, 100, passed away January 18, 2015.
Helen was born January 2, 1915 in Czechoslovakia and moved to the U.S. at age 13 and to Clearwater in 1953. She was the owner of Highland Beauty Salon and Helen's Beauty Salon, both in Clearwater. She was a successful business woman with a zest for life and truly lived the American dream. She had just celebrated her 100th birthday on January 2nd.
Helen was a member of St. Michael's Catholic Church Women's Guild and was also a member of the Red Hat Society. She enjoyed bowling, and loved playing Bingo. She was also very artistic and was a top class seamstress. She was an excellent cook and absolutely loved having family over and serving everyone.
Helen was preceded in death by her husband John S. Melko and son John S. Melko, Jr. She is survived by her daughter Lillian (Jack) Spangler; grandchildren Jill (Dennis) O'Connor, Lisa (Ed) Bishop, Jack (Jill) Spangler, Jr., Thomas (Kandy) Spangler, Erika (Rob) Murdocca, Jennifer (Barton Gilmore) Melko; 15 great grandchildren and 1 great great grandson.
